10 Possible Superhero Shows For DC’s New Digital Service

What a time to be a DC fan! Yesterday, news dropped that Warner Bros. Digital Network will launch a new DC digital service in 2018. While the contents of the service are mostly a mystery, details were revealed about two new series: Titans and Young Justice: Outsiders. Obviously, it's like Christmas in April, but everyone is still asking, what other superhero shows could be in the pipeline for this new service?

Batman: The Animated Series

No, not a reboot or repeat, but a continuation of the award-winning animated series. While it did sort of continue as The New Batman Adventures, it would be best if the revived show was set in the original continuity of the far-superior Batman: The Animated Series.

With Mark Hamill and Kevin Conroy still lending their voices to the Joker and Batman, respectively, it shouldn’t be too hard to get the old gang back together for another season. Also, with the renewed popularity of lesser-known characters in the DCEU and comic books, it presents an excellent opportunity to inject fresh blood into the series.

Due to the success of Batman on the big screen, it’s unlikely that we’ll see a live-action Dark Knight TV series in the near future. That said, not one single person will complain if we get another season of Batman: The Animated Series in its place. Celebrating 25 years since its release this year, Bruce Timm and Eric Radomski’s fabled show lives on as one of the greatest animated TV series of all-time. If Young Justice can enjoy a revival, why can’t this?
